The process of acquiring a collection of books based on their content, history, rarity, or other bibliographic characteristics. A person who systematically acquires books in a specific field of knowledge, or within certain historical or bibliographic parameters, is known as a book collector.

For a brief but fascinating essay on the history of book collecting, please see A Dictionary of Book History by John Feather (New York: Oxford University Press,1986) beginning on page 36.
